11. What does the personification 'The waves tickled the beach' mean?
 
The waves gently touched the beach.
 
The waves were trying to make the beach laugh.
 
The waves were very strong and hit the beach.
 
The beach was ticklish.
10. What is the meaning of the simile 'He was as busy as a bee'?
 
He was very hard-working and active.
 
He was flying around like a bee.
 
He was trying to make honey.
 
He was annoyed by a bee.
9. What is the meaning of the metaphor 'The world is a stage'?
 
Life is like a play, with people acting out different roles.
 
The world is  a place where actors perform.
 
Everyone in the world is an actor.
 
The world is a very big stage.
8. Combine the sentences using adjectives: 'The girl saw the dog. The dog was brown and fluffy.'
 
The girl saw the brown, fluffy dog.
 
The girl saw a dog that was brown. It was also fluffy.
 
The dog was brown and fluffy, so the girl saw it.
 
The brown girl saw the fluffy dog.
7. Combine the clauses to make a personification: 'The rain fell.' 'The clouds cried.'
 
The clouds cried tears of rain.
 
The rain was as wet as tears from a crying cloud.
 
The clouds were crying, so it rained.
 
The rain was a river of tears from the sky.
6. Combine the clauses to make a simile: 'The boy was nervous.' 'His heart beat like a drum.'
 
The nervous boy's heart beat like a drum.
 
The boy's heart was a drum because he was nervous.
 
The nervous boy's heart drummed.
 
The boy was as nervous as a drum.
5. Choose the best adjective to complete the sentence: 'The ___ knight bravely faced the dragon.'
 
fearless
 
scary
 
quickly
 
bravery
4. In the sentence, 'The fluffy kitten played with the red ball,' what is the adjective?
 
fluffy
 
kitten
 
played
 
ball
3. Find the sentence that uses personification.
 
The house groaned as the tornado hit.
 
The house was a fortress.
 
The house was like a prison.
 
The house was very old.
2. Which sentence uses a metaphor?
 
Her laugh was music to his ears.
 
She sang like a bird.
 
The wind whispered secrets through the trees.
 
Her laugh was loud.
1. Which of the following sentences contains a simile?
 
The boy ran as fast as a gazelle.
 
The boy was a gazelle on the field.
 
The sun smiled down on the boy.
 
The boy was a cheetah who ran quickly to the finish line.
